Salernitana signed Israeli striker Shon Weissman from Granada on the transfer deadline, while Jerome Boateng can arrive tomorrow as a free agent.

The contract was literally deposited in the final moments before the window shut in Italy at 19.00 GMT.

Weissman had been on the verge of joining Spezia in Serie B earlier in the evening when he suddenly backed out of the transfer.

Salernitana director Walter Sabatini dived into action and managed to complete the deal in record time.

They were also able to get the international transfer paperwork completed and registered with seconds to spare.

Weissman has arrived on loan from Granada, having scored one goal in six competitive games this season.

Salernitana had also been in talks with Cagliari for Eldor Shomurodov, who is on loan from Roma, but that did not go through.

The window is closed, but not for free agents, so Salernitana have plenty of time to register Boateng as a free agent later this week.
